About the Dhelmise V Pokémon Card

Dhelmise V is a Grass-type Pokémon card with 220 HP from the Shining Fates set, part of the Sword & Shield series. It carries the collector number 9/72 and is classified as Rare Holo V. The Shining Fates set was released on February 19, 2021.

Dhelmise V Pokémon Card Details

Card name: Dhelmise V

Card number: 9/72

Set: Shining Fates

Series: Sword & Shield

Rarity: Rare Holo V

Subtypes: Basic, V

Type: Grass

HP: 220

Artist: Eske Yoshinob

Release date: February 19, 2021

National Pokédex number: 781

Grading the Dhelmise V Pokémon Card

Whether Dhelmise V is worth grading comes down to condition. Before submitting a card, collectors usually check front and back centring, corner sharpness, edge wear, surface defects, and any print lines or factory imperfections.

Across the hobby, top grades such as PSA 10, BGS/Beckett 9.5–10, and CGC Pristine 10 generally command a premium over raw or lower-graded copies.

PSA has graded 113 copies of this card, of which 45 earned a PSA 10 — a gem rate of about 39.8%. These population figures were last refreshed on June 15, 2026.
